Public Safety Committee
Regular MeetingRoswell, NM · February 13, 2024
Minutes
Public Safety Committee Meeting
Held at City Hall Large Conference Room,
Tuesday February 13, 2024 at 4:30 p.m.
Notice of this meeting was given to the public in compliance with Section 10-15-4, NMSA 1978
and Resolution 24-02.
The meeting convened at 4:30 p.m. with Councilor Julianna Halvorson presiding, Councilor
Carlos Marrujo, Councilor Angela Moore and Councilor Matthew Chappell being present.
Staff present: Mike Mathews, Deputy City Manager; Lance Bateman, Police Chief; Toby Franco,
Code Enforcement Supervisor; Chad Cole, City Manager; Teri Best, Pecos Valley Regional
Communication Center; Karen Sanders, Emergency Manager; Steve Chavez, Division Chief;
Jessica Vickers, Community Development Director; Amalia Martinez, City Clerk; Della Andazola,
Deputy City Clerk.
Guests: Rita Kane Doerhoefer.

REGULAR ITEMS
3. Condemnation Resolution 24-XX: Mr. Franco presented Resolution 24-XX for
consideration. Councilor Moore moved to send to full council on the consent agenda.
Councilor Marrujo was the second. A voice vote was as follows: Councilor Halvorson –
yes, Councilor Marrujo – yes, Councilor Moore – yes, Councilor Chappell – yes, the
motion passed 4-0.
4. Consider scope of work for RFP 24-010 Threats and Hazards Identification and Risk
Assessment (THIRA) and Stakeholder Preparedness Review (SPR). Councilor Marrujo
moved to send RFP 24-010 scope of work to the full council on the consent agenda.
Councilor Moore was the second. A voice vote was as follows: Councilor Halvorson –
yes, Councilor Marrujo – yes, Councilor Moore – yes, Councilor Chappell – yes, the
motion passed 4-0.
5. Consider Public Safety Committee meeting times, Committee members discussed
monthly meeting times. After discussion and no objection, the Chair appointed 4 pm as
the meeting time.
NON-ACTION ITEMS
6. Review and discussion on Chapter 4 of the City Code. Mr. Mathews provided a clean copy of
section 4 of the city code and a red line version of some changes discussed the year prior.
Committee was asked to review and item would be on next agenda to discuss any possible
changes.

Public Participation
Rita Kane Doerhoefer asked if money from the grant the city applied for and received
could be used on county animals. Mr. Mathews referred Ms. Doerhoefer to Best Friends
who may be able to help with county owned animals.
